Historical Event on 7/6/1901

Dr. Shyama Prasad Mukherjee, great social reformer, politician and leader, was born at Calcutta. He was the founder of the ""Bharatiya Jana Sangh"", of which BJP is the successor party. His father Sir Asutosh was widely known in Bengal.
